When a compressible wave is sent towards bottom of sea from a stationary ship it is observed that its echo is hear after `2s`. If bulk modulus of elasticity of water is `2xx10^(9)N//m^(2)`, mean temperature of water is `4^(@)` and mean density of water is `1000kg//m^(3)`, then depth of sea will be

A

707 m

B

1414 m

C

2828 m

D

`2000 xx 10^(3) m`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

`v = (2x)/(t)`
`2x = v t = sqrt((k)/(rho))t`
`2x = sqrt((2 xx 10^(9))/(10^(3)) xx 2`
`x = sqrt2 xx 10^(3) = 1.414 xx 10^(3)`
`x = 1414 m`
